2008-01-31-1222-40-744×1024

The finest hand drawn map of London I’ve ever seen!

Published 06/09/2010 at 744 × 1024 in London, Enguhlund 2007, 2008

Proudly powered by WordPress
Theme: Esquire by Matthew Buchanan.